First of all, the major understanding hole lies in the necessity for more practical procedures and tools with the early detection of TB. ordinarily, TB prognosis has relied on sputum swab microscopy [5]. This investigation is greatly accessible and cost-efficient. on the other hand, it has constraints with regards to sensitivity [five]. Recent advancements in TB diagnostics have brought forth ground breaking applications that have revolutionized early detection [6]. These involve molecular tests for instance nucleic acid amplification assays (e.g., the GeneXpert MTB/RIF assay), that may promptly detect the presence of TB microorganisms and concurrently determine drug resistance [seven]. These molecular tests have demonstrated larger sensitivity and specificity, enabling earlier detection even in circumstances with minimal bacterial burden [8]. Secondly, addressing this hole is vital for quite a few factors. The brand new growth of level-of-care diagnostics need to assistance for early detection of TB [nine]. These systems possess the opportunity to expand usage of TB diagnostics in useful resource-minimal configurations [ten]. However, Irrespective of these improvements, a number of troubles persist with regard towards the early detection of TB [11]. constrained entry to diagnostics in producing international locations hampers early detection of TB [twelve]. Delays in diagnosing TB might be attributed to numerous components past stigma, not enough consciousness, and reluctance to seek medical treatment [thirteen]. These incorporate restricted access to diagnostic services, socio-financial obstacles, plus the complexity in the illness’s presentation, which may typically mimic other much less severe illnesses [thirteen]. well timed TB analysis brings about extra productive client treatment. It minimizes the burden of Superior TB circumstances on wellness units, and facilitates qualified public wellbeing interventions to regulate the spread of the condition [14]. Early detection of TB is very important for productive disorder administration and Management [one]. The sensitivity and specificity of TB testing has actually been improved by improvements in diagnostic technological innovation [15]. nonetheless, it stays essential to handle the challenges connected to accessibility, consciousness, and stigma to accomplish common and timely detection of TB conditions [16].

Tuberculosis is classed as among the list of granulomatous inflammatory health conditions. Macrophages, epithelioid cells, T lymphocytes, B lymphocytes, and fibroblasts mixture to sort granulomas, with lymphocytes encompassing the infected macrophages. When other macrophages assault the infected macrophage, they fuse together to kind a large multinucleated cell inside the alveolar lumen. The granuloma may stop dissemination on the mycobacteria and supply a neighborhood surroundings for interaction of cells in the immune process.
